Output 34c8cf3105399b14cdeab5faee0cb934ee5474f986f1845ca5024e3d7c2929c9:24

value
166878
script pubkey
OP_0 OP_PUSHBYTES_32 a53c5328ec9e468b52cdf1b4980ebea6827c9943c7cc510f8eff5e83b8e349d3
address
bc1q5579x28vnergk5kd7x6fsr4756p8ex2rclx9zruwla0g8w8rf8fstl0nru
transaction
34c8cf3105399b14cdeab5faee0cb934ee5474f986f1845ca5024e3d7c2929c9
confirmations
102760
spent
true